chore: Enable more clang-tidy checks (#3054)

This commit is contained in:
Alex Kremer
2026-05-01 15:31:45 +01:00
committed by GitHub
parent d6bae6c12b
commit 51244feb4a
239 changed files with 1150 additions and 733 deletions

View File

@@ -129,11 +129,11 @@ TEST_F(LedgerCacheSaveLoadTest, saveAndLoadFromFile)
auto const blob1 = cache.get(key1, kLEDGER_SEQ);
ASSERT_TRUE(blob1.has_value());
EXPECT_EQ(blob1.value(), objs.front().data);
EXPECT_EQ(blob1.value(), objs.front().data); // NOLINT(bugprone-unchecked-optional-access)
auto const blob2 = cache.get(key2, kLEDGER_SEQ);
ASSERT_TRUE(blob2.has_value());
EXPECT_EQ(blob2.value(), objs.back().data);
EXPECT_EQ(blob2.value(), objs.back().data); // NOLINT(bugprone-unchecked-optional-access)
auto const tmpFile = TmpFile::empty();
auto const saveResult = cache.saveToFile(tmpFile.path);
@@ -149,11 +149,11 @@ TEST_F(LedgerCacheSaveLoadTest, saveAndLoadFromFile)
auto const loadedBlob1 = newCache.get(key1, kLEDGER_SEQ);
ASSERT_TRUE(loadedBlob1.has_value());
EXPECT_EQ(loadedBlob1.value(), blob1);
EXPECT_EQ(loadedBlob1.value(), blob1); // NOLINT(bugprone-unchecked-optional-access)
auto const loadedBlob2 = newCache.get(key2, kLEDGER_SEQ);
ASSERT_TRUE(loadedBlob2.has_value());
EXPECT_EQ(loadedBlob2.value(), blob2);
EXPECT_EQ(loadedBlob2.value(), blob2); // NOLINT(bugprone-unchecked-optional-access)
EXPECT_EQ(newCache.latestLedgerSequence(), cache.latestLedgerSequence());
}
@@ -174,10 +174,11 @@ TEST_F(LedgerCacheSaveLoadTest, saveAndLoadFromFileWithDeletedObjects)
auto const blob2 = cache.get(key2, kLEDGER_SEQ);
ASSERT_TRUE(blob2.has_value());
EXPECT_EQ(blob2.value(), objs.back().data);
EXPECT_EQ(blob2.value(), objs.back().data); // NOLINT(bugprone-unchecked-optional-access)
auto const deletedBlob = cache.getDeleted(key1, kLEDGER_SEQ - 1);
ASSERT_TRUE(deletedBlob.has_value());
// NOLINTNEXTLINE(bugprone-unchecked-optional-access)
EXPECT_EQ(deletedBlob.value(), objs.front().data);
// Save and load
@@ -192,6 +193,7 @@ TEST_F(LedgerCacheSaveLoadTest, saveAndLoadFromFileWithDeletedObjects)
// Verify deleted object is preserved
auto const loadedDeletedBlob = newCache.getDeleted(key1, kLEDGER_SEQ - 1);
ASSERT_TRUE(loadedDeletedBlob.has_value());
// NOLINTNEXTLINE(bugprone-unchecked-optional-access)
EXPECT_EQ(loadedDeletedBlob.value(), deletedBlob);
// Verify active object
@@ -200,7 +202,7 @@ TEST_F(LedgerCacheSaveLoadTest, saveAndLoadFromFileWithDeletedObjects)
auto const loadedBlob2 = newCache.get(key2, kLEDGER_SEQ);
ASSERT_TRUE(loadedBlob2.has_value());
EXPECT_EQ(loadedBlob2.value(), blob2);
EXPECT_EQ(loadedBlob2.value(), blob2); // NOLINT(bugprone-unchecked-optional-access)
EXPECT_TRUE(newCache.isFull());
EXPECT_EQ(newCache.latestLedgerSequence(), cache.latestLedgerSequence());